330ml bottle. Clear dark brown colour with average, frothy to creamy, fairly lasting, minimally lacing, off-white head. Dark malty aroma with a toffee touch. Taste is moderately sweet dark malty with a toffee note, caramel, hints of roast.

05/12 On tap in some inn near Atletico Madrid stadium. Poured golden body with medium sized froth head. Grainy, corny and grass hop aroma. Flavor was sweet, corny with inferior hops. Medium bodied with long finish that showed some corn acidity. This is supposed to be their premium over cinco estrellas, well, both are pieces of crap.

01/12 0.33 l bottle from a Carrefour in Madrid. It poured clear brownish body with medium sized ocher head. A bit toasted, caramel aroma. Slightly sweet caramel flavor with some grainy and herbal hop bitter bite. Medium in body with corresponding caramel and slightly alcoholic finish. I had a feeling it would be an OK macro beer and it really is.
